Entendendo a Função do DNS: A Base da Conexão na Internet

A função do DNS (Domain Name System) é uma das partes mais fundamentais da infraestrutura da Internet. Sem ele, navegar na web como conhecemos hoje seria quase impossível. Este artigo se propõe a explorar os múltiplos aspectos do DNS, sua importância em serviços de TI e como ele se relaciona com provedores de internet, oferecendo uma visão abrangente que pode ser de grande ajuda tanto para profissionais quanto para iniciantes na área.

O Que é DNS?

O DNS é um sistema hierárquico de nomeação que traduz nomes de domínio legíveis por humanos (como valuehost.com.br) em endereços IP legíveis por máquinas (como 192.0.2.1). Essa tradução é crucial, pois permite que os navegadores e outros dispositivos se conectem a servidores web e outros serviços disponíveis na Internet.

Por Que a Função do DNS é Essencial?

A importância do DNS não pode ser subestimada. Ele atua como uma agenda telefônica da Internet, permitindo que os usuários acessem websites sem precisar memorizar sequências numéricas. Abaixo estão algumas razões pelas quais a função do DNS é fundamental:

  • Acessibilidade: Facilita o acesso a sites ao traduzir nomes de domínio para endereços IP.
  • Desempenho: A utilização de servidores DNS eficientes pode melhorar o tempo de resposta de navegação.
  • Segurança: O DNS é uma ponte crítica para a segurança online, com medidas como DNSSEC que ajudam a proteger contra fraudes.
  • Gerenciamento de Tráfego: Permite que empresas gerenciem seus tráfegos, redirecionando usuários para servidores mais próximos.

Como Funciona o DNS?

O funcionamento do DNS envolve várias etapas e componentes. Vamos detalhar o processo principal de resolução de nomes:

  1. Requisição: Quando um usuário digita um URL no navegador, o dispositivo consulta um servidor DNS para resolver esse nome.
  2. Servidor Recursivo: O servidor DNS recursivo verifica se já tem a correspondência em cache. Se não, ele inicia uma busca em outros servidores DNS.
  3. Root Name Server: O servidor recursivo primeiro consulta um root name server, que é o servidor DNS de mais alto nível.
  4. Servidores TLD: O root fornece informações sobre quais servidores TLD (Top Level Domain) são responsáveis pelo domínio, como .com ou .br.
  5. Servidor Autoritativo: O servidor DNS autoritativo para o domínio é consultado, que finalmente fornece o endereço IP correspondente ao nome de domínio.
  6. Resposta: O endereço IP é retornado ao navegador, que pode então se conectar ao site desejado.

Tipos de Registros DNS

Dentro da configuração DNS, existem vários tipos de registros, cada um desempenhando um papel específico. Alguns dos tipos mais comuns incluem:

  • A: Registros que mapeiam um nome de domínio para um endereço IPv4.
  • AAAA: Analogamente ao registro A, mas para endereços IPv6.
  • CNAME: Um alias que redireciona de um domínio para outro domínio.
  • MX: Define os servidores de correio a serem usados para um domínio.
  • TXT: Permite que um domínio inclua informações de texto, frequentemente usada para configuração de segurança como SPF.

A Função do DNS em Serviços de TI

No contexto de serviços de TI, a função do DNS se expande para incluir aspectos críticos como:

Gerenciamento de Redes

Empresas utilizam o DNS para gerenciar redes de forma eficiente. Com configurações adequadas, o DNS pode ajudar a:

  • Redirecionar usuários para servidores mais rápidos.
  • Fortalecer a segurança por meio de configuração de registros que protejam domínios contra ataques.
  • Manter a continuidade do serviço durante falhas, redirecionando tráfego para servidores backup.

Monitoramento e Análise

O DNS também desempenha um papel vital no monitoramento do tráfego de rede. Organizações podem usar registros DNS para:

  • Registrar e analisar o tráfego de entrada e saída.
  • Identificar padrões que podem indicar ameaças ou falhas.
  • Monitorar a performance e otimizar o tempo de resposta do servidor.

Desafios e Soluções Relacionadas ao DNS

Embora a função do DNS seja crítica, também enfrenta desafios, como:

  • Segurança: O DNS é suscetível a ataques como DNS Spoofing e DDoS.
  • Cache: A cache de registros DNS pode levar a problemas de atualização e inconsistência.
  • Escalabilidade: À medida que a Internet cresce, o sistema DNS deve acompanhar a demanda em constante mudança.

Medidas de Segurança para Proteger o DNS

Para mitigar esses desafios, existem várias práticas de segurança recomendadas, como:

  • DNSSEC: Uma extensão que adiciona uma camada extra de verificação e segurança aos registros DNS.
  • Monitoramento Contínuo: Implementação de soluções de monitoramento contínuo para detectar anomalias.
  • Atualizações Regulares: Manter servidores e software de DNS sempre atualizados com as últimas correções de segurança.

A Função do DNS em Provedores de Internet

Os provedores de Internet (ISPs) têm um papel vital na manutenção e operação do sistema DNS. Eles oferecem servidores DNS que os usuários configuram em seus dispositivos. Uma boa política de DNS pode oferecer:

  • Alta disponibilidade: Garantindo que os servidores DNS estejam sempre acessíveis.
  • Desempenho rápido: Com caches efetivos para melhorar a velocidade de resolução de nomes.
  • Atendimento ao cliente: Suporte técnico para resolver questões relacionadas ao DNS rapidamente.

Conclusão

A função do DNS é, sem dúvida, uma das bases essenciais da Internet moderna. Compreender seu funcionamento não só ajuda a apreciar a complexidade da tecnologia por trás da navegação web, mas também auxilia empresas a otimizar sua presença online e usuários a garantir uma experiência de internet mais segura e confiável. Para quem busca serviços em áreas relacionadas a TI ou provedores de internet, conhecer esses aspectos pode gerar uma vantagem competitiva significativa. Lembre-se, investir em um sistema DNS robusto e seguro é fundamental para qualquer negócio que deseja prosperar no ambiente digital.

funcao do dns

Comments